Transaction 34f0f736dcbe18355964fd5e7ebcaf94dd25c0515ff6a22f4ce14f9fde527414
1 Input
1 Output
-
34f0f736dcbe18355964fd5e7ebcaf94dd25c0515ff6a22f4ce14f9fde527414:0
- value
- 2896953
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 340c744ad6227e8852c7b78d907f2ddbf03ef3c6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15kD4K9KRe2pmjvQUUer644Uu8BeaSzWQK